CARAUSIUS, A.D. 287-293. BI Double-Denarius (Antoninianus), Uncertain Mint. NGC Ch EF.
RIC-513. Obverse: Radiate, draped and cuirassed bust right; Reverse: Providentia standing left, holding patera and cornucopia. Displaying a somewhat weak strike for the type, this example shows very little evidence of handling and no major issues.
